NASA LEADERS TO MENTOR NEW YORK STUDENTS ON MARCH 22

WASHINGTON -- NASA is hosting a March 22 forum in New York City to 
share the excitement of space exploration and encourage students - 
especially girls - to pursue careers in science, technology, 
engineering and mathematics (STEM). 

NASA's Deputy Administrator Lori Garver and NASA's Associate 
Administrator for Education Leland Melvin, a former astronaut, will 
attend the event and meet with 200 middle school and high school 
students from the Women's Academy of Excellence; the Promise Academy; 
the New York City Housing Authority; and the General D. Chappie James 
Middle School of Science. 

Fashion designer Donna Karan's Urban Zen Foundation and the Foundation 
for Advancing Women Now, founded by singer Mary J. Blige are co-hosts 
of the event, which will take place from 9:30 a.m. to 1 p.m. EDT at

At 10:15 a.m., the students also will participate in a 
question-and-answer session with NASA astronaut Cady Coleman who is 
orbiting 220 miles above the Earth. She has been living aboard the 
International Space Station for the past three months. NASA 
Television and the agency's website will carry the downlink live. 

The downlink is one in a series with educational organizations in the 
U.S. and abroad to improve STEM teaching and learning. It is an 
integral component of Teaching From Space, a NASA Education office. 
The office promotes learning opportunities and builds partnerships 
with the education community using the unique environment of 
microgravity and NASA's human spaceflight program.
